OpenEdv-开源电子网

 找回密码
 立即注册
正点原子全套STM32/Linux/FPGA开发资料,上千讲STM32视频教程免费下载...
查看: 5462|回复: 0

什么是Crater?(第二天)

[复制链接]

20

主题

76

帖子

0

精华

金牌会员

Rank: 6Rank: 6

积分
1027
金钱
1027
注册时间
2019-5-27
在线时间
142 小时
发表于 2019-9-22 20:46:54 | 显示全部楼层 |阅读模式
本帖最后由 清夏 于 2019-9-24 22:06 编辑

      今天看了看机器人的资料,我们的机器人是属于高级版的,用luby控制器来控制的,机器人的程序可以用Crater来编写,也可以用keil来编写(第一次接触用图写程序的软件,好高级啊)  
      下面我给大家介绍一下什么是Crater
      Crater是一个图形化交互式机器人控制程序开发工具,操作贼便捷(就是你拖动一个图,它自动给你写出程序)。Crater采用的是模块图——代码的结构。
      软件的代码区是基于 USDG 强大的函数封装功能实现的。 软件根据用户连接的模块图生成基于 usdg 和 c 语言的代码。此代码保存为文件,我们将在用户需要编译的情况下调用 arm 编译器编译成 LuBy 控制器需要的文件。并且在用户需要的情况下下载到控制器里供用户选择使用。

      也就是说我们在Ctrater写出代码,再用arm编译器(我也不知道是个什么东东)将代码编译成LuBy控制器需要的形式,在拷进机器人的LUBY控制器里就好了。。。丫的这么简单???
      还有就是我们的机器人是分两个开关的,一个管的是LUBY控制器,另一个管的是电机。(大爷的我一开始只知道控制器的开关,打开之后机器人只是原地抽搐,差点没把我吓坏。。。)

正点原子逻辑分析仪DL16劲爆上市
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则



关闭

原子哥极力推荐上一条 /2 下一条

正点原子公众号

QQ|手机版|OpenEdv-开源电子网 ( 粤ICP备12000418号-1 )

GMT+8, 2024-11-25 11:27

Powered by OpenEdv-开源电子网

© 2001-2030 OpenEdv-开源电子网

快速回复 返回顶部 返回列表